MySQL存储过程是一种强大的数据库编程工具,可以帮助开发人员在数据库中执行复杂的操作。然而,在开发过程中,我们经常需要在控制台输出一些信息,以便调试和排错。今天,我将揭秘MySQL存储过程控制台输出语句的使用方法,让你成为技术大牛!
一、为什么需要控制台输出语句?
在开发过程中,我们需要不断地调试和修改代码。如果没有控制台输出语句,我们很难知道代码执行的情况,更难以找出错误。因此,控制台输出语句是一个非常重要的调试工具。
二、如何在MySQL存储过程中使用控制台输出语句?
在MySQL存储过程中,我们可以使用SELECT语句来输出信息。下面的代码可以输出一条消息:
SELECT 'Hello World!';
如果你想输出变量的值,可以使用CONCAT函数。下面的代码可以输出一个变量的值:
ame VARCHAR(50);ame';ame, '!');
三、如何在控制台中查看输出信息?
在MySQL命令行工具中,我们可以使用“\G”命令来查看输出信息。下面的代码可以输出一条消息,并使用“\G”命令查看输出:
SELECT 'Hello World!' \G
输出结果如下:
*************************** 1. row ***************************
Hello World! set (0.00 sec)
四、如何将输出信息写入日志文件?
除了在控制台中查看输出信息之外,我们还可以将输出信息写入日志文件。在MySQL中,我们可以使用log文件来记录日志信息。下面的代码可以将输出信息写入log文件:
sg VARCHAR(50);sgessage.';essagesg);
在上面的代码中,log_table是一个表,用于记录日志信息。通过INSERT语句,我们可以将消息写入该表中。
在MySQL存储过程中使用控制台输出语句是一个非常重要的调试工具。通过掌握控制台输出语句的使用方法,我们可以更加高效地开发和调试代码。